After Their AI Models Hacked Real Companies, AI Labs Call for Stronger Cyber Defenses

Changelly
Bitbuy


In brief

  • More than 100 organizations signed an open letter calling for stronger global cyber defenses.
  • Models built by signatories OpenAI and Anthropic recently compromised real systems during security evaluations.
  • The letter recommends stronger access controls, monitoring, threat sharing, and oversight of autonomous agents.

Leading AI developers are telling governments and businesses to strengthen their networks after models built by OpenAI and Anthropic compromised other companies’ systems.

In an open letter released Thursday, OpenAI, Anthropic, and more than 100 other organizations warned that AI-enabled cyberattacks are about to become more common and that companies have “a limited window to strengthen cyber defenses.”

“In the coming months, AI-enabled cyber attacks will become far more widespread and sophisticated,” the letter said. It identified hospitals, water treatment plants, and internet infrastructure among the services at risk.

The letter recommends funding defensive AI tools, sharing threat intelligence, restricting access to sensitive systems, and improving security for critical infrastructure. However, failures in those areas allowed OpenAI and Anthropic models to breach systems outside their test environments.

Other signatories include Google, Microsoft, Amazon Web Services, Cisco, CrowdStrike, Cloudflare, Mastercard, Visa, and Robinhood. Hugging Face, whose production infrastructure OpenAI’s models breached, also signed the letter.

AI models breach live systems

Anthropic said in a July 30 incident report that the earliest of three breaches dated to April, but did not provide an exact date for each. Claude Opus 4.7 accessed a production database after mistaking a real company for a simulated target, while Claude Mythos 5 uploaded a malicious package that ran on 15 systems.

According to OpenAI’s incident timeline, released earlier this week, an agent created the first entry on an unauthorized message board on May 12 and obtained unintended internet access on May 26. On July 10, agents found exposed Hugging Face credentials; over the next two days, they exploited previously unknown vulnerabilities, executed code on Hugging Face servers, and obtained production credentials.

Hugging Face disclosed the intrusion on July 16, and OpenAI acknowledged its models’ involvement on July 21.

Between July 25 and July 28, the U.K. AI Security Institute recorded 19 out-of-scope actions involving Claude Mythos 5 and GPT-5.6 Sol. In the most serious case, an agent submitted malicious code to a real open-source project and used fake identities to pressure its maintainer to approve it.

On Thursday, an independent investigation found that roughly 1,200 OpenAI agents had coordinated through the unauthorized message board, with about 700 joining the Hugging Face operation.

Crypto developers put AI on defense

Crypto developers are already using AI to search for flaws before attackers find them. The Bitcoin Red Team used models including Moonshot AI’s Kimi K3 to scan hundreds of open-source Bitcoin projects, reporting thousands of potential vulnerabilities. Because the affected projects were not identified, many of those findings have not been independently verified.

The Ethereum Foundation has also deployed groups of AI agents against network infrastructure, uncovering a peer-to-peer software bug that was later fixed. BitBox said an AI-assisted audit found two severe vulnerabilities in its wallet firmware, while a researcher using Claude Opus 4.8 discovered a critical flaw in Zcash that had survived years of human review.

Labs recommend tighter controls

The letter lays out a division of labor for preventing the next breach, including organizations patching vulnerable software, restricting permissions, strengthening authentication, and inspecting AI-generated code because the “status quo security won’t be enough,” the signatories said.

Security companies should test their defenses against frontier models and share verified fixes, while governments should fund protection for hospitals, utilities, and other essential services.

AI developers are asked to improve monitoring and make autonomous agents traceable to their operators. The coalition also wants defenders to use advanced models to find vulnerabilities and analyze attacks, which would put more capable agents inside sensitive systems and increase the need for containment.

OpenAI and Anthropic tightened their testing procedures after the breaches. The letter, however, sets no binding standards or requirements for independent oversight, and U.S. law offers little guidance on who is responsible when an AI system accesses an unauthorized network.

The letter ended by urging industry and government leaders to put AI tools in the hands of defenders and share the fixes that work:

“Put cyber-capable AI in the hands of defenders, starting with the teams protecting essential services,” the letter said. “Together, we can turn today’s AI advances into lasting improvements in security that benefit everyone. Let’s put them to work.”
